## Deployment Notes

Before deploying Querent, be aware of the planner regression introduced in release 12: nested joins can fall back to sequential scans unless the statistics cache is warmed. Always run the warmup job after schema changes, and verify plan shapes in staging first. The planner currently ships with the following configuration values.

service settings:
novath:
  pin: 1396
  tenant: pelys
  seal: seal_ccc035e1
  metrics_host: metrics.novath.qorvelworks.test
  standby_team: fraeth
  escalation: drueth-zorok
  nonce: 61d508

Welcome to the Lattix support rotation. Lattix is our school timetable solver used by district planners to generate conflict-free schedules. Most tickets involve stuck solver jobs; you can requeue these from the admin console. To query job status directly against the internal scheduling service, use the credential below, which is rotated quarterly by the platform team.

app token of bahaf-tajeg = zpat23_SjjsllwiLmXbtS65veZaV47

Handover note — Crumbwheel order cutoffs.

Welcome aboard. The bakery cutoff rule in Crumbwheel closes same-day orders at 14:00 local to each storefront, not UTC — this has bitten us twice. Holiday overrides live in the calendar service and take precedence silently, so always check there first when a cutoff looks wrong. To unlock the calendar service's admin console after a restart, enter the recovery passphrase below.

vault phrase of bagap-bahaf = silion-pelox-sorox-casdor-quenwyn-fraax-eliox-praael-kelion-quenvan-kasox-rusael-norius-belvan